Kristen Doute, Tayshia Adams, Jill Zarin, Joe Amabile and Lauren Speed-Hamilton are among the contestants vying for reality TV supremacy in the Prime Video show's new trailer

This May, the greatest reality TV star of all time will be crowned!

On Tuesday, Prime Video unveiled the trailer for its upcoming series The GOAT, which features some of the biggest names from The Bachelor, Love Is Blind, Big Brother and Real Housewives vying for reality TV supremacy and a $200,000 prize.

In PEOPLE's exclusive first look at the teaser, host Daniel Tosh jokes the contestants will have to put their "strength and lack of life skills" to the test if they want to walk away with the title of reality TV GOAT.

"No one has dared to find out who is the best at just being on a reality show," Tosh says at the start of the wild trailer, which includes Bachelor star Joe Amabile attempting to pick up bugs with his mouth, 90 Day Fiancé alum Paola Mayfield being "milked" and Shahs of Sunset's Reza Farahan voicing his concern that his diarrhea is not being taken seriously.

The rest of the all-star cast is rounded out by The Bachelorette's Tayshia AdamsVanderpump Rules'Kristen DouteLove Is Blind's Lauren Speed-Hamilton and Real Housewives of New York City's Jill Zarin.

CJ Franco (FBoy Island), Wendell Holland (Survivor), Teck Holmes (The Real World, The Challenge), Alyssa Edwards/Justin Johnson (RuPaul's Drag Race), Da'Vonne Rogers (Big Brother, The Challenge), Joey Sasso (The Circle, Perfect Match) and Jason Smith (Holiday Baking Championship) are also set to compete.

Per a press release obtained by PEOPLE, the series promises to show "new sides of longtime favorites."

Over the course of 10 episodes, the 14 stars will live together in GOAT manor, where they will go head-to-head in 20 challenges, forming and breaking alliances along the way until just one contestant remains. The last reality TV star standing will earn the coveted title of GOAT — and the cash prize.

"Prepare cuz there's about to be ugly crying, lots of fighting," the stars tease in the trailer. "It's going to get nasty!"

The GOAT boasts big-name producers, including black-ish alum Anthony Anderson, Lee Eisenberg (The Office, Jury Duty), Elan Gale (The Bachelor franchise, FBoy Island, Midnight Mass) and Bill Dixon (The Bachelor franchise, FBoy Island),

The first three episodes of The Goat will premiere May 9 on Prime Video and Amazon Freevee. New episodes will follow each Thursday until the June 27 finale.
